A website is not automatically useful just because it is online.

For a service business, the real question is not whether you can build a website yourself. The real question is whether that website helps a visitor understand your services, trust your business, and take the next step toward an inquiry.

That is where the diy vs professional website decision matters.

A DIY website can make sense when you need a simple online presence. But if your website is expected to support quote requests, consultations, bookings, or higher-value leads, the decision becomes less about saving money upfront and more about avoiding lost opportunities.

A low-cost website can still become expensive if it quietly loses serious prospects.


The Real Difference Between a DIY Website and a Professional Website

The main difference is not just who builds the site.

It is what the site is built to accomplish.

A DIY website usually starts with a basic goal: get something online. That can be enough for a new business that only needs a homepage, contact details, and a simple explanation of services.

A professional website starts with a different goal: help the right visitor understand the business, trust the offer, and take action.

That changes the build.

The homepage, service pages, calls to action, mobile layout, copy, trust signals, and contact path all need to work together. If those pieces are handled casually, the site may look acceptable but still fail to generate inquiries.

This is why the website builder vs developer comparison should not be reduced to tools. A website builder gives you a way to publish pages. A developer should help shape the website around the way customers actually decide.


When a DIY Website Makes Sense

A DIY website can be the right move when the business is early, the budget is limited, or the website is not expected to do much yet.

For example, a contractor may need a simple page to show a phone number and service area. A consultant may need a temporary site while the offer is still being developed. A local service provider may only need a basic online presence because most leads still come from referrals.

In those cases, DIY can solve the immediate problem: the business has a place online.

The risk starts when that starter website becomes the main sales asset.

If the business begins relying on the site for quote requests, consultations, or booked work, a basic DIY setup may no longer be enough. The site may exist, but it may not explain the business clearly enough to convert serious visitors.


Business owner reviewing a DIY website and considering whether it may be costing the business leads.

When a DIY Website Starts Costing You Leads

A DIY website becomes a business problem when it creates friction the owner does not notice.

The site may load. The contact form may work. The design may look clean enough. But visitors may still leave because the website does not give them enough clarity, confidence, or direction.

This is common for service businesses because buyers compare options before making contact.

A visitor may be choosing between multiple contractors, consultants, legal professionals, or local providers. If your website feels unclear, generic, unfinished, or difficult to act on, they may never ask for clarification.

They will simply move to another business that feels easier to understand and safer to contact.


Visitors Cannot Quickly Understand What You Do

One of the most common DIY website problems is unclear messaging.

Many service business websites use broad statements like “Quality Solutions You Can Trust” or “Professional Services for Your Needs.” That type of copy may sound safe, but it does not help the visitor decide.

A strong website should quickly answer:

What do you do?
Who do you help?
Where do you work?
What problem do you solve?
What should the visitor do next?

If those answers are not obvious, the website creates hesitation.

The consequence is simple: confused visitors leave. They usually do not contact the business to ask what the website failed to explain.

The correction is stronger positioning. The site should make the business specific, relevant, and easy to evaluate.


The Website Looks Generic Instead of Trustworthy

A generic website can weaken trust even when the business itself is experienced.

This often happens when a site relies too heavily on templates, stock sections, vague service descriptions, or copy that sounds like every other provider in the market.

For service businesses, that is a serious problem.

A contractor needs to show capability. A consultant needs to show clarity. A legal professional needs to show credibility. A local service provider needs to show reliability.

If the website feels interchangeable, the business starts to feel interchangeable.

That is one of the practical differences in the website builder vs developer decision. A website builder may help you create pages, but a professional build should help your business feel specific, credible, and easier to choose.


The Contact Path Is Weak or Buried

A visitor should not have to work hard to contact a service business.

Many DIY websites place the contact button in only one area, bury the form at the bottom, or use calls to action that do not match how customers actually inquire.

Someone looking for a quote should not have to search through multiple pages to find the next step. Someone looking for a consultation should not be left wondering whether to call, email, book, or submit a form.

Weak contact flow creates avoidable lead loss.

The visitor may already be interested, but if the next step is unclear, they may delay the decision or leave entirely.

The correction is not simply adding more buttons. The website needs a clear path from interest to action, with contact options placed where the visitor is most likely to be ready.


Website Builder vs Developer: What You Are Really Paying For

The website builder vs developer decision is often framed as a cost comparison, but that is too narrow.

A website builder gives you tools: templates, editing controls, design blocks, and a way to publish pages.

A developer should give you a more complete build process: structure, planning, customization, mobile refinement, service page organization, conversion flow, and a site built around the business goal.

The difference is responsibility.

With a website builder, the business owner is responsible for the strategic decisions. That includes page layout, messaging, service hierarchy, user flow, mobile experience, calls to action, and lead capture.

With a professional developer, those decisions should be handled with the business outcome in mind.

That is what the investment is really for.


Website Builders Give You Control, But Also More Responsibility

Website builders are useful because they give business owners control.

You can choose a template, add your content, edit pages, and publish without needing to understand every technical part of web development.

But control also means responsibility.

You are responsible for deciding what goes on the homepage, how services are organized, what copy appears first, where the calls to action belong, how the mobile layout works, and whether the site feels credible to a serious buyer.

That is where many DIY sites fall short.

The owner may know the business well, but that does not automatically make the website clear to a new visitor. What feels obvious internally may not be obvious to someone comparing providers for the first time.

The consequence is a site that explains too little, says too much in the wrong places, or fails to guide visitors toward contact.


A Developer Builds Around the Business, Not Just the Template

A professional website should be built around the business model, not just the available design blocks.

That means the developer should understand the services, the target customer, the decision process, the proof needed to build trust, and the actions the website should encourage.

For a service business, this may include clearer service pages, stronger homepage positioning, better calls to action, visible trust signals, industry-specific messaging, and a cleaner path to inquiry.

The goal is not to make the website more complicated.

The goal is to make the business easier to understand and easier to contact.

This is where hiring a developer becomes strategic. The value is not only in building pages. It is in shaping the website so each page has a job and each section supports the visitor’s decision.


Hire Web Developer or Not? Use This Decision Filter

The question hire web developer or not depends on what the website needs to accomplish.

DIY may be enough if the website only needs to confirm that your business exists.

Hiring a developer becomes the stronger decision when the website needs to help generate inquiries, support credibility, explain services clearly, and convert visitors into leads.

A service business owner should not evaluate the website only by upfront cost. The better filter is the role the website plays in the business.

If the site is part of how customers find, judge, and contact you, it needs to be built with that responsibility in mind.


DIY May Be Enough If You Only Need a Basic Online Presence

DIY can work when the business is not relying heavily on the website yet.

That may apply if most leads come from referrals, the business is still testing its offer, or the website only needs to show basic information for a short period.

In that situation, paying for a full professional build may not be necessary.

The important point is to treat the DIY site honestly. It may be a starter asset, not a long-term lead-generation system.

The mistake is expecting a basic DIY website to perform like a professionally planned sales tool.

If the business grows but the website stays at the same level, the site can start holding the business back.


Hire a Developer If Your Website Needs to Generate Real Inquiries

Hiring a developer makes more sense when the website is expected to support real business outcomes.

That includes quote requests, booked calls, consultations, project inquiries, local service leads, or higher-value client decisions.

At that point, the website needs to do more than present information. It needs to reduce hesitation.

A visitor should understand the service, see why the business is credible, know whether the company handles their type of problem, and feel clear about the next step.

If those pieces are missing, the business may lose leads even when people are visiting the site.

This is why a professional website should be evaluated as an investment in clarity, trust, and conversion, not only as a design expense.


Hire a Developer If Your Current Website Looks Fine But Does Not Convert

Some websites do not look broken.

They may have a clean design, a few service pages, and a working contact form. But they still fail to generate consistent inquiries.

This is often a quiet conversion problem.

The message may not be strong enough. The page flow may not match how buyers make decisions. The service pages may be too shallow. The calls to action may appear too late. The site may not give visitors enough proof to feel confident.

A website can look fine and still underperform.

That is often the point where a website audit or professional review makes sense. Before rebuilding everything, the business owner needs to know whether the issue is structure, content, design, mobile usability, or the offer presentation.


The Biggest Risk of a DIY Website Is Losing Trust

A weak website does not only affect how the business looks.

It affects how much the visitor trusts the business.

For service businesses, trust is often the difference between a visitor contacting you or choosing someone else. The visitor may be considering a home project, a legal matter, a business service, or a local appointment. In each case, they want to feel that the provider is reliable before they reach out.

A DIY website can weaken that trust when it feels incomplete, unclear, outdated, or too generic.

The business may be experienced, but the website may not communicate that experience well.

That gap matters because buyers can only judge what the website shows them.


Service Buyers Look for Proof Before They Contact You

Service buyers usually look for signs that a business is legitimate and capable before they make contact.

Those signs may include clear service descriptions, real project examples, reviews, service areas, process details, FAQs, business information, and easy contact options.

When those signals are missing, the visitor has to make assumptions.

That creates risk.

If another business explains the service better, shows stronger proof, and makes the next step easier, the visitor may choose that business instead.

The correction is to build trust into the website structure. Trust should not be limited to one testimonial section. It should be supported throughout the site.


A Generic Website Makes Price the Main Comparison

When a website does not communicate value clearly, visitors often compare based on price.

That is not always because they are bad leads. Sometimes the website has failed to show why the business is different, more qualified, more reliable, or better suited to the visitor’s problem.

If every provider looks the same online, the cheapest option becomes easier to justify.

That can lead to lower-quality inquiries, more price shoppers, and fewer serious conversations.

A stronger website helps change the comparison.

It gives visitors better reasons to choose the business beyond cost, such as process, specialization, proof, communication, service quality, or local experience.


A Professional Website Should Make the Business Easier to Choose

A professional website should make the decision easier for the visitor.

That does not mean overwhelming them with information. It means giving them the right information in the right order.

The website should clarify the offer, explain who the service is for, answer likely objections, show proof, and make the next step obvious.

In the diy vs professional website decision, this is one of the most important differences.

A DIY site often depends on the visitor figuring things out. A professional site should guide the visitor through the decision with less friction.

That guidance affects inquiry quality.

When visitors understand the service before they contact you, they are more likely to ask better questions and take the next step with clearer intent.


Clear Service Pages Help Visitors Find the Right Fit

Many service business websites rely too much on broad service summaries.

That creates a problem when visitors are looking for something specific.

A contractor may offer several types of work. A consultant may serve different business needs. A legal or professional service provider may handle different case types or service categories.

If everything is compressed into one vague page, the visitor may not know whether the business handles their exact problem.

Service-specific pages solve that problem.

They allow the website to explain each offer clearly, address specific concerns, and guide the right visitor toward contact.

The consequence of weak service pages is missed relevance. The business may offer the service, but the website does not make that clear enough for the visitor to act.


Stronger Page Structure Helps Visitors Move Toward Contact

Page structure affects how people make decisions.

A strong service page should not be a random collection of sections. It should move the visitor from problem recognition to service fit, then into proof, process, objections, and action.

That order matters.

If the website asks for contact before the visitor understands the service, the call to action may feel premature. If the site gives too much detail before showing relevance, the visitor may lose interest. If proof appears too late, trust may never build.

The correction is intentional structure.

Each section should answer the next question in the visitor’s mind. That is how a website becomes easier to follow and more likely to generate inquiries.


Better Messaging Makes the Business Feel More Specific and Credible

Messaging is often where DIY websites become weak.

The copy may describe the business in broad terms but fail to communicate why the business is the right choice for a specific type of customer.

A professional service business should not sound interchangeable.

The website should reflect the actual work, the customer’s problem, the service area, the business’s process, and the kind of outcome the visitor is looking for.

Specific messaging builds credibility because it shows that the business understands the situation.

Generic messaging creates doubt because it forces the visitor to fill in the blanks.

A stronger website removes that burden.


When a Website Audit Makes Sense Before a Full Rebuild

Not every underperforming website needs an immediate full rebuild.

Sometimes the smarter first step is a website audit.

An audit helps identify whether the problem is design, copy, structure, mobile layout, page flow, technical setup, or weak calls to action.

That matters because business owners often guess at the problem.

They may think the site needs a new design when the real issue is unclear messaging. They may think they need more traffic when the existing pages are not converting. They may think the homepage is the issue when service pages are actually where visitors lose confidence.

A good audit creates clarity before money is spent on the wrong fix.


Audit the Site If You Are Getting Visitors But Few Inquiries

Traffic without inquiries usually points to a conversion problem.

The site may be attracting visitors, but something is preventing them from taking the next step.

Common causes include unclear service positioning, weak trust signals, buried contact options, thin service pages, poor mobile flow, or a mismatch between what visitors need and what the page explains.

The consequence is wasted opportunity.

More visitors will not solve the problem if the website does not help them become leads.

An audit can identify where the drop-off is likely happening and whether the site needs targeted improvements, a redesign, or a deeper rebuild.


Audit the Site If You Are Unsure Whether to Redesign or Rebuild

Business owners often know their website is not working, but they are unsure what level of fix is needed.

That is where an audit is useful.

It can separate small issues from structural problems.

A few content improvements may be enough if the site already has a strong foundation. A redesign may be needed if the visual presentation and page flow are weakening trust. A full rebuild may be the better option if the site is poorly organized, hard to update, technically messy, or no longer aligned with the business.

This helps answer the hire web developer or not question with more confidence.

Instead of guessing, the business owner can make the decision based on what the website actually needs.


DIY vs Professional Website: The Better Choice Depends on the Job Your Website Needs to Do

The better choice depends on the job of the website.

A DIY website can work when you need a basic online presence, have limited budget, and are not relying on the site to generate serious inquiries.

A professional website becomes the better choice when the website needs to support trust, explain services clearly, guide visitors, and help turn interest into contact.

For service businesses, that distinction matters.

Your website is often part of the buyer’s decision before they ever speak to you. If it creates confusion, weakens trust, or makes the next step harder, it can quietly cost you leads.

The diy vs professional website decision should not be based only on what is cheaper to launch.

It should be based on what your business needs the website to accomplish.


Get a Website That Is Built Around Leads, Not Just Looks

If your current website is only acting as an online brochure, it may not be doing enough for your business.

A stronger website should clarify your services, support trust, guide visitors, and make inquiries easier.

For some businesses, that starts with a website audit. For others, it means a redesign or a full rebuild around a clearer structure.

The right next step depends on where the current site is failing.

If your website is not helping serious visitors become inquiries, PixelCrafted can review the structure, messaging, and lead path to identify what needs to change before more opportunities are lost.

Not sure why your website isn’t generating leads?

PixelCrafted helps service businesses identify where their website is losing leads and whether it needs better structure, clearer messaging, or a full rebuild.
Insights

Related Articles